The Raiders signed three-time Pro Bowl safety Jamal Adams, a source said, reuniting him with coach Pete Carroll, whom he played under in Seattle.
In his eight-year NFL career (Seahawks, Jets, Titans, Lions), Adams has played in 85 games and recorded 501 tackles, 21.5 sacks, seven forced fumbles, 36 passes defensed and four interceptions.
